On Tuesday, Ukrainian and Russian officials met for face-to-face peace talks in Istanbul, Turkey.  The peace talks ended with no real agreements.

A few days after the invasion peace talks were held across the border in Belarus. And there were some Zoom negotiations a few days later. But it has been 3 weeks since the countries talked in the now 5-week-old war.

So far, Russia has continued to bombard both military and non-military targets. And Ukraine continues to push the Russian troops back from the capital city.

Peace talks in Turkey

Turkey is one of the few countries that is remaining neutral. Turkish President Recep Tayyip Erdoğan opened the peace talks calling for “both sides to stop this tragedy.”

Ukrainian presidential adviser Mykhailo Podolyak delivered an address in Turkey. 

He outlined the key issues to reporters. And claimed that Ukraine needed an “agreement on international security guarantees” for Ukraine. “Only with this agreement can we end the war as Ukraine needs,” he said.
